What is the difference between Software Operations Manager vs Software Engineer?

AspectSoftware Operations ManagerSoftware Engineer
Primary FocusOversees software deployment, maintenance, and operational efficiencyDesigns, develops, and tests software applications
Required SkillsProject management, system administration, process optimizationProgramming, software development, debugging
Work EnvironmentOperations teams, IT departments, cross-functional collaborationDevelopment teams, coding environments, R&D labs
CertificationsITIL, PMP, cloud certificationsProgramming languages, software development certifications

The Software Operations Manager focuses on managing software systems' deployment and operational efficiency, while the Software Engineer concentrates on creating and coding software applications. Both roles require technical knowledge, but their responsibilities and skill sets differ significantly, catering to different stages of the software lifecycle.

What does a software operations manager do in a software company?

A software operations manager oversees the daily functioning of software systems, ensuring smooth deployment, maintenance, and performance. They coordinate between development, IT, and support teams, often using tools like monitoring software and project management platforms to optimize operations and meet organizational goals.

Company Description

Zayo provides mission-critical bandwidth to the world's most impactful companies, fueling the innovations that are transforming our society. Zayo's 141,000-mile network in North America and Europe includes extensive metro connectivity to thousands of buildings and data centers. Zayo's communications infrastructure solutions include dark fiber, private data networks, wavelengths, Ethernet, and dedicated Internet access. Zayo serves wireless and wireline carriers, media, tech, content, finance, healthcare and other large enterprises.
